How Our Leak Detection Services Work
At our company, we understand the importance of a thorough and accurate leak detection process. Our technicians will inspect your property inside and out to identify any signs of water damage or potential issues.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ters, to detect even the smallest leaks and track their origin. Our goal is to provide you with a comprehensive understanding of the situation and the steps needed to resolve the issue quickly and effectively.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our trained technicians will conduct a thorough visual inspection of your property, looking for signs of water damage, discoloration, or warping. This step helps us identify potential areas of concern and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Leak Detection and Location
Using specialized equipment, we’ll detect and locate the source of the leak. This may involve using thermal imaging cameras to visualize temperature differences or moisture meters to measure humidity levels.
Step 3: Containment and Repair
Once the source of the leak is identified, our technicians will take steps to contain the damage and prevent further water from entering the affected area. This may involve installing temporary barriers or fixing pipes and appliances.
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-strength dr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the affected area. This helps prevent mold growth and further damage.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, our team will work on repairing any damaged areas, replacing any affected materials, and ensuring your property is safe and secure. This may involve patching walls, replacing flooring, or repairing appliances.

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Look out for these common indicators of potential leaks: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ant smells can be a sign of moisture buildup or mold growth. If you notice persistent odors in your home, it’s time to investigate further.
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ls
Discoloration or warping on ceilings and walls can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, act quickly to prevent further issues.
Peeling Paint and Wallpaper
Peeling paint and w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up or water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s time to investigate further.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, act quickly to prevent further issues.
Increased Water Bills
Unexplained increases in your water bills can be a sign of leaks or water waste. Investigate further to identify the source of the issue.
Visible Water Damage or Leaks
Visible signs of water damage or leaks need immediate attention. Don’t hesitate to call us if you notice these signs.

Leak Detection Services Cost In Hemet, CA
The cost of leak detection services in Hemet,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can serve as a guide for homeowners in the area: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of the affected area, severity of the issue, and local conditions. |
| Leak Detection and Location |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of the issue, size of the affected area, and equipment required. |
| Containment and Repair |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and materials required.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ment required, and duration of the process.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and materials required. |
